Has anybody every used the SUAD - an oral device - to help correct Sleep Apnea?
i have mild sleep apnea and i am soon to begin using a SUAD. it is an oral device that keeps the tongue and lower jaw in place to prevent it from blocking the airway. i am searching for any personal feedback.
Answers:
I have heard from patients that used it and said they prefer the CPAP. I guess the SUAD causes some strain on the jaw muscles and you wake up with your mouth hurting. I have also heard some complaints of very dry mouth with it as well.
